Warranty
If you are thinking of purchasing treadmills, it is important to consider the warranty. A good warranty will save you money in the long run, if your treadmill requires to be repaired or replaced. A good warranty should cover all major components and even the cost of labor. Some treadmills come with an unlimited warranty, whereas others only offer a 1-year warranty. It is important to know what each company provides.
When reviewing a treadmill warranty first, the most important thing to consider is the coverage for electronics and parts. This is because it will determine if the treadmill is repairable. A lot of treadmills that are cheap have 90 days of warranty on electronics and parts. A good warranty should last 2 to 5 years, depending on the manufacturer.
The next thing you should do is check the warranty on the frame. A frail frame can ruin your workout and pose an accident hazard. A good frame warranty should last from 10 to 15 years. Consider the kind of exercise you want to do, and how often you will use the treadmill. This will help you determine the amount of horsepower you need. Many brands will promote "peak" power, which is perfect for marketing. But it's better to focus on continuous" horsepower as that's the kind of power you'll receive from the motor.
The physical size of the treadmill is also a aspect to consider, particularly in the event that you're limited on space in your home. It's worth measuring your space to make sure that the machine fits, and be careful to factor in any clearance needed for mounting/dismounting. The maximum weight that can be supported by the user is another factor to look out for. If you are an avid runner, you will want to make sure the machine is capable of handling your training.
